La corriente en un circuito se triplica conectando una R1 = 500 Ω en paralelo con la resistencia R del circuito. Determinar R en

ausencia de R1

Answer:

R = 1000 ohm

Explanation:

In a circuit with a resistor R, the current is

           V = i R

            i₀ = V / R

a resistor R₁ is placed in parallel and the current is tripled i = 3 i₀

           V = i Req

            i = V / Req

           3i₀ = V / Req

           

we substitute

           3 (V / R) = V / Req

           3 / R = 1 / Req

           R = 3 Req

the equivalent resistance of the two resistors in parallel is

            \frac{1}{R_{eq}} =  \frac{1}{R} + \frac{1}{R_1}\frac{1}{R_{eq}} = \frac{R_1 + R}{R \ R_1}

             

              R_{eq} = \frac{R \ R_1}{R + R_1}

              R / 3 = \frac{R \ R_1}{R + R_1}

              ⅓ (R₁ + R) = R₁

              R = 3R₁ -R₁ = 2 R₁

              R = 2 500

              R = 1000 ohm

Explain how a book can have energy even if it is not moving.
frutty [35]
Can something have energy even if it's not moving?
All moving objects have kinetic energy. When an object is in motion, it changes its position by moving in a direction: up, down, forward, or backward. ... Potential energy is stored energy. Even when an object is sitting still, it has energy stored inside that can be turned into kinetic energy (motion).


Does a book at rest have energy?
A World Civilization book at rest on the top shelf of a locker possesses mechanical energy due to its vertical position above the ground (gravitational potential energy).



Does a book lying on a table have energy?
The book lying on a desk has potential energy; the book falling off a desk has kinetic energy.
